Avoid Basement Flooding with a Sump Pump System

A sump pump system functions as a crucial defense against basement flooding. This effective device includes a sump pit, which collects water that flows into your basement. A submersible pump then expels the collected water outside of your home, preventing flooding.

To guarantee the efficiency of your sump pump system, periodic maintenance are essential. This includes keeping the basin free from debris and testing the pump's functionality.

Choosing the Right Sump Pump for Your Basement Needs

Protecting your home's foundation from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many options available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the capacity of your basement and the amount of rainfall your area typically experiences. A powerful pump may be necessary if you live in a region prone to heavy rainfall.

It's also important to select between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the sump. Submersible pumps are generally more reliable, but pedestal pumps may be easier to maintain.

Finally, don't forget about a secondary power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.

Dealing With Common Sump Pump Issues

A sump pump is a vital part for protecting your house from inundation. While they are generally reliable, there are some common troubles that can arise. Here's a look at some of the most frequent sump pump concerns and how to address them.

One common situation is a defective switch. If the mechanism isn't detecting water, the pump won't turn on. Examine the sensor for dirt.

Another common cause is a blocked discharge pipe. This can occur from sediment building up in the tube. Clean the channel to improve water flow.

Finally, a faulty electrical component is another option. If your pump won't start, it may be time to upgrade the pump unit. Routine inspections can help avoid these common issues.
